What a registered agent?

An registered agent denotes a representative or a corporate entity designated to receive juridical and legal documents on in representation of a business. Such a role is vital for compliance with local regulations requiring businesses to have a reliable point of contact for important notices. Registered agents are responsible for receiving process service notifications, tax papers, and other critical information that could impact a business's legal status.

The registered agent needs to maintain an physical office address in that state where the business operates or registered. This ensures that there is forever a location where official documents can be served, providing security and ensuring that companies do not miss essential alerts. Whether the business constitutes a liability-limited company, a business entity, or non-profit organization, having a registered agent supports maintain compliance with government requirements.

In alongside receiving documents, registered agents may additionally assist with yearly compliance, ensuring that businesses remain up to date with submission obligations and cut-off dates. By managing legal documents and offering compliance support, registered agents perform a vital role in the efficient functioning and longevity of a company.

Significance of Hiring a Official Agent

Hiring a licensed agent is crucial for business owners as it ensures adherence with local regulations. A registered agent serves as the official point of contact for official documents and government notifications, allowing business owners to focus on their core operations without the stress of overlooking important deadlines. Furthermore, having a registered agent improves the legitimacy of a enterprise by providing a business presence in the state where the business is established.

Another significant benefit of engaging a registered agent is the protection of your privacy. Using a registered agent service allows entrepreneurs to list the agent's address on public documents instead of their own, keeping personal information private. This is particularly useful for business owners who operate from home or wish to keep a distinct boundary between their personal and business lives.

Moreover, licensed agents provide important reminders for compliance deadlines and assist with annual filings, helping businesses stay organized and avoid financial penalties. This help is crucial for maintaining good standing with the authorities, which is essential for the sustainability and prosperity of any business venture.

Startup founders also often ask about how to update their registered agent. The procedure typically involves sending a registered agent change form to the state department and may entail payment of a small fee. It's important to ensure that your new registered agent is ready to perform the responsibilities required by law.
